#68d003 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#68d003 is composed of 40.8% red, 81.6%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.6%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 90.4 degrees, a saturation of 97.2% and a lightness of 41.4%. #68d003 color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ff06 with #00a100. Closest websafe color is: #66cc00.

#68d003 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#68d003 has RGB values of R:104, G:208,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0.5, M:0, Y:0.99,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 6868995.
